.blogDiv {
 max-width: 800px;
  margin-left: auto;
  margin-right: auto;
  margin-top: 1rem;
}

.h1Blog {
  margin-left: 1rem;
  color: white;
}

.h2Blog {
  font-size: 1.5rem;
  margin-left: 2rem;
  margin-top: 2rem;
  color: white;
}

.pBlog {
  font-family: 'Noto Sans Display', sans-serif;  
  margin-left: 2rem;
  color: white;
  font-size: 1.17rem;
}

@media (max-width: 600px) {
    .h2Blog {
        font-size: 1.5rem;
  
        margin-left: 1rem;
        margin-top: 2rem;
        color: white;
      }
    .blogDiv {
        margin-left: 0vw;
        margin-top: 1rem;
      }
      .pBlog {
        font-family: 'Noto Sans Display', sans-serif;  
        margin-left: 5vw;
        color: white;
        font-size: 1.17rem;
      }
  }